			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Congratulations to our students who were recognized at the Young Artists Awards. Joey Luthman won Best Performance in a Short Film <em>Young Actor</em> for his lead role as James Charm in &#8220;Save the Skeet&#8221; and Jordan Van Vranken was nominated for Best Performance in a TV Series <em>Guest Starring Young Actress</em> for her role on &#8220;Criminal Minds.&#8221; Congratulations, we are so proud of both of you!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Set clear goals!</p>
<blockquote><p>You must see your goals clearly and specifically before you can set out for them. Hold them in your mind until they become second nature.<br />
- Les Brown</p></blockquote>
<p>If your goal is to book more television, including a series pilot this season, then set up a plan of action that will add value to your skills in that market.</p>
<p>1. Be sure to practice your acting skills every day. 15 minutes of cold reading practice will REALLY keep you sharp if you do it EVERY DAY. If you aren&#8217;t super sharp at cold reading, then practice for AN HOUR PER DAY until it becomes as effortless as breathing.</p>
<p>2. Break down a new scene every day and get the rhythms of the speech. Go on the SIDES services and download as much material as you can and work on it.</p>
<p>3. TV IS FAST&#8230;so SPEED UP your speech patterns. One of the problems I&#8217;ve seen is actors practicing at a SLOW pace, when the shows are performed at a RAPID pace.</p>
<p>4. If you aren&#8217;t taking workshops EVERY CHANCE YOU GET, then you aren&#8217;t building your KNOWLEDGE and INFORMATION base within the industry. SO MUCH OF WHAT YOU LEARN is unique to a show, a network, a production company, or a producer/writer. The more knowledge you have the MORE EFFECTIVE you are at using your skills. Plus WORKSHOPS keep you sharp by having you work your cold reading scenes under the practiced eye of a BUSY Coach.</p>
<p>5. Be BUSY, and postcard your successes and do your drops at key offices so you are constantly reminding the industry WHO YOU ARE!<br />
Make sure you have a GOOD REASON to send a postcard, however, like a booking, a play, an airing, a new agent, a premiere, or some other STRONG REASON that says I&#8217;M BUSY and WORKING and IN DEMAND! Postcards for their own sake are wasted.</p>
